About The Position

Under the direction of the Director of Fiscal Services, performs complex technical work in the development, monitoring, maintenance, and analysis of District budgets, Associated Student Body (ASB) accounts, school attendance accounting, and related fiscal functions; prepare federal, state and other reports; assist in the development and implementation of the annual district budget; assist in coordinating district-wide budgetary functions; and performs related work as required.

Requirements

  • Knowledge of generally accepted accounting principles, including California school district budgeting and accounting.
  • Knowledge of California School Accounting Manual (CSAM).
  • Knowledge of Standardized Account Code Structure (SACS).
  • Knowledge of financial and statistical record-keeping techniques.
  • Knowledge of research, data collection, and financial analysis.
  • Knowledge of preparation of reports and financial documentation.
  • Knowledge of applicable laws, codes, regulations, standards, policies, and procedures.
  • Knowledge of computer-based software programs that support this level of work, including but not limited to, word processing, spreadsheets, custom databases, and financial management systems.
  • Knowledge of modern office practices, procedures, and equipment use.
  • Minimum of two years of progressively responsible accounting and budget experience in a school district or government agency.
  • DOJ and FBI Criminal Background Check upon conditional offer of employment.
  • TB Test within the last 60 days upon conditional offer of employment.
  • Complete district Mandated Reporter training, Sexual Harassment, etc. upon conditional offer of employment.
